A sharp Lemon Sachet Mixture: This is a favorite of mine to include in my lingerie drawers. 1 cup dried crushed lemon verbena leaves
1 cup dried lavender flowers
1 cup dried crushed scented geranium leaves
¼ cup dried crushed peppermint leaves
¼ cup dried crushed lemon peel strips
muslin or cheesecloth bags
colorful ribbon
- Combine the crushed leaves, lemon peel strips and lavender flowers together in a bowl.
- Evenly divide the mixture between several small sachet bags, filling ¾ full to allow the tops to be secured with a rubber band.
- Tie the tops of the bags with a length of ribbon.
- Place the sachets to pleasantly scent linens, clothes, and furs, in your closets and drawers.
